New Teslas drive themselves off the line at Giga BerlinAutonomously navigating the factory premises, they stop by the on-site Supercharger, then park in the outbound lot https://t.co/QxHYQl07yM ...

Market Focus - Tesla Japan officially starts testing FSD (Supervised) in Yokohama [1] - Domestic release timing depends on company development progress and regulatory approvals [1] Technological Advancement - Testing FSD Supervised in Yokohama, one of the first Japanese ports opened to foreign trade [1]

Model Development - Tesla is training a new Full Self-Driving (FSD) model with approximately 10 times the parameters, indicating a significant increase in model complexity and potential capabilities [1] - The new FSD model incorporates a substantial improvement in video compression loss, which could lead to better data utilization and performance [1] - Tesla anticipates a public release of the new FSD model by the end of next month, contingent on successful testing [1]
